    Panasonic wall split inverter problem



    REQUIRE FAULT CODE DIAGNOSIS CS-CUE15HKR
    CODE H11
    UNIT IS ONLY ONE DAY OLD

    Re: Panasonic wall split inverter

    Comms error.
    See if you have ~20-30v at the indoor unit between the neutral and the signal terminal after reseting the power.
    If not, somethings wrong with the wiring or ourdoor unit.
    If you have that voltage there, somthing is wrong with the indoor unit.

    Re: Panasonic wall split inverter problem

    H11 is the first fault code that pops up when checking fault codes, are you sure it is H11? move up and down using the timer buttons to confirm.

    If it is H11, than the indoor unit has not had a reply from the outdoor units for 60 seconds, communications are performed over interconnects 2 and 3.

    Check your interconnect for poor connections or shorts

    If all connections are good, than measure beteeen them on the DC range, and it should be fluctuating between 20 and 50 V DC

    If it is, than it may be a faulty indoor PCB, if it is not, than disconnect number 3 at the outdoor unit, and measure what comes out of the PCB on 3, in reference to number 2,it should be about 20 - 70 Vdc
    If this voltage is not there, than the outdoor PCB may be faulty

    Re: Panasonic wall split inverter problem

    Good point.
    When you get into test mode, the error isn't displayed on the controller, you use the time up and down buttons to scroll through the codes, watching for the code that makes the indoor unit beep multiple times (5?).
    It starts the codes at H11, so go scrolling through the m all and back to H11 to confirm it's a H11 fault and not something else.
